Diagnostyka is the market leader in laboratory diagnostics in Poland, operating a nationwide network of laboratories, blood collection points, and diagnostic imaging facilities. During MidEuropa’s ownership, the company was transformed into a highly scaled and consolidated platform, combining strong organic growth with an active acquisition strategy.
MidEuropa supported the company in building a leading healthcare brand and accelerating its expansion through systematic market consolidation. Over time, Diagnostyka developed a broad network serving both individual patients and a large base of institutional clients.
By 2025, Diagnostyka had become one of the most prominent healthcare platforms in Central and Eastern Europe, culminating in a landmark public listing on the Warsaw Stock Exchange and validating its position as a scalable, market-leading diagnostics business.

Built the market-leading laboratory diagnostics platform in Poland
Developed a nationwide network including over 1,100 blood collection points, 156 laboratories and 19 imaging facilities
Completed 128 M&A transactions, driving rapid market consolidation
Achieved strong long-term growth, with revenues expanding at a 24% CAGR since initial investment
Established one of the most recognisable healthcare brands in Poland
Funding history
Initially acquired by MidEuropa Fund III in 2011 as a platform investment
Further supported through continued investment and acquisition-led expansion
Successfully exited via IPO. At the time of listing, the Diagnostyka IPO was one of the largest IPOs on the Warsaw Stock Exchange in the preceding five years and raised gross proceeds of just over €400 million for MidEuropa’s investors, with the company’s market capitalisation reaching over €1 billion in the first hours of trading
